Transaction 35ebba55575409e60e4a8cf858df961cefac0907724ce317e12ffb94fa8b0895

1 Input
2 Outputs
  • 35ebba55575409e60e4a8cf858df961cefac0907724ce317e12ffb94fa8b0895:0
  • value  1000996872
    address  1D52FC2UVRSUAccbEMKjsLaBY2nNN1QRWG
  • 35ebba55575409e60e4a8cf858df961cefac0907724ce317e12ffb94fa8b0895:1
  • value  24339573
    address  36MCmCRzyFVAe5GRuHkoHSPKG2kwicFySZ